Ryan Day and the Ohio State Buckeyes just landed their quarterback of the future. Dylan Raiola, a five-star prospect in the 2024 cycle, has committed to OSU.
The highly-touted prospect out of Chandler, Ariz. announced his commitment to the Buckeyes on Monday night.
Plucking top recruits from the West Coast is nothing new at Ohio State. C.J. Stroud is a California kid.
There was speculation Raiola had interest in top West Coast programs like Oregon or maybe USC, but Ohio State was too good to pass down.

Football runs in Raiola’s DNA; he’s the son of former Detroit Lions offensive lineman Dominic Raiola.
The 6-foot-3, 220-pound quarterback, meanwhile, will join the Buckeyes in 2024.
